U.S. v. WEISSBERGER

No. 91-3181.

951 F.2d 392 (1991)

UNITED STATES of America, Appellee, v. Mark Alan WEISSBERGER, Appellant.

United States Court of Appeals, District of Columbia Circuit.

Decided November 15, 1991.

Rehearing and Rehearing Denied January 10, 1992.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

Santha Sonenberg, Asst. Federal Public Defender, with whom A.J. Kramer, Federal Public Defender was on the memorandum, for appellant.

Ann K.H. Simon, Asst. U.S. Atty., with whom Jay B. Stephens, U.S. Atty., and John R. Fisher, Asst. U.S. Atty., were on the brief, for appellee. Roy W. McLeese, III, Asst. U.S. Atty., also entered an appearance for appellee.

Before EDWARDS, SENTELLE and HENDERSON, Circuit Judges.


Rehearing and Rehearing En Banc Denied January 10, 1992.

Opinion for the Court filed by Circuit Judge HARRY T. EDWARDS.

HARRY T. EDWARDS, Circuit Judge:

This is an appeal from a decision of the District Court requiring a 30-day competency examination and pretrial detention of appellant Mark Alan Weissberger.
